Discover the Power of MRI for Tinnitus Relief

Tinnitus, characterized by ringing or buzzing in the ears, can be a frustrating and debilitating condition for many individuals. Fortunately, advancements in medical technology have paved the way for more effective diagnosis and treatment options. MRI, or magnetic resonance imaging, has emerged as a crucial tool in the understanding and management of tinnitus. By providing detailed images of the brain and inner ear, MRI can help healthcare professionals pinpoint the underlying causes of tinnitus and develop personalized treatment plans.

MRI plays a vital role in the comprehensive evaluation of tinnitus by allowing healthcare providers to visualize the structures and pathways involved in auditory processing. Through high-resolution imaging, MRI can identify any abnormalities or irregularities in the auditory system that may be contributing to tinnitus symptoms. This detailed insight enables healthcare professionals to tailor treatment strategies to address the specific needs of each individual, leading to more targeted and effective interventions.
